- 5Work consistently. All of the thinking and planning in the world isn’t going to matter if you don’t eventually take action to make your big goal a reality. You need to work toward your goals every single day. It doesn’t matter how slow you work or how long it takes to see results. If you work consistently toward a goal, eventually you’re going to get there.
- Creating a schedule for when in your day you work on each step toward your big goal can help you stay consistent. Set aside a certain amount of time each day at the same time each day to work. This prevents you from getting sidetracked by other things and guarantees that you stay consistent.
- Remember that taking action doesn’t necessarily mean accomplishing something really big every day. If you one of your steps for writing a best-selling book is getting an agent, don’t get down on yourself if all you contribute toward accomplishing that step in one day is researching potential agents. You have to take the first step to take the second and as long as you’re taking action, it doesn’t matter how big or small the action is.[7][8][9][10][11]

If you want to start thinking big, don't be afraid to entertain difficult or improbable ideas. For example, if you want to be a writer, think about what it would be like to be a bestselling author, and use that to motivate you. If you don't have any big ideas at the moment, set aside time every day just to think, like while you're going on a walk or drinking your morning coffee. Once you've come up with a great idea, break it down into small steps so you can turn it into a reality. For example, if your goal is to publish a book, first you'd need to come up with a story idea, then you'd need to write an outline, and so on.
